Ok, got this tractor, sorry, not the Ford, Diesel , it has not been mainteained in a while. I need some thing that I can spray on and hose off to take the grease, spilled diesel and crud off.. Got any ideas? Was thinking about Simple green, btw, cold engine since I can't get it started, that is whey I need to clean it, to get to the battery cables for ground and hot.

If you don't mind removing some paint along with the grease EAsy off in the yellow can or the cheap generic brand at your local store will remove the heck out of that grease. If you leave it on really long it will also loosen up the paint.

Purple Castrol Cleaner it will take grease off no problem. It is a High Detergent Cleaner and will even fade paint and remove some. Scrape off the big chunks then just spray this on and rince and spray again till clean. A pressure washer works great with it. Mark H.
